Main Panel Installation in Utah County, UT

Main panel installation services involve upgrading or replacing the primary electrical panel that supplies power to a home or property. This project is often necessary when the existing panel can no longer support additional electrical demands, or if it has become outdated or damaged. Property owners may request this service during home renovations, when adding new appliances or systems, or to improve overall electrical safety and reliability. The process typically includes disconnecting the old panel, installing a new one that meets current electrical standards, and ensuring proper connection to the property’s wiring system.

Before requesting main panel installation, property owners should understand the capacity of their current electrical system and whether an upgrade is needed to support new appliances or technology. It’s also important to consider the location of the panel, potential permits required, and the overall condition of the existing wiring. Clarifying these details can help ensure the new panel meets the property’s electrical needs and complies with local codes. Proper planning and assessment can facilitate a smooth installation process and enhance the safety and functionality of the electrical system.

FAQ

Main Panel Installation Questions

What is a main panel installation? It involves replacing or upgrading the electrical panel that distributes power throughout a property, ensuring safe and efficient electrical service.

When is a main panel upgrade recommended? Upgrades are often needed when the existing panel is outdated, overloaded, or not compliant with current electrical codes.

What types of properties typically need main panel installation? Residential homes, commercial buildings, and rental properties may require panel upgrades to meet electrical demands.

What should property owners consider before installing a new main panel? It’s important to assess current electrical needs, compatibility with existing wiring, and any local code requirements.
